Transaction 2c240999e678d71fb29ea1b2aa5980ded794453c81a81e8134d92178b9558f99

3 Input
2 Outputs
  • 2c240999e678d71fb29ea1b2aa5980ded794453c81a81e8134d92178b9558f99:0
  • value  1234039
    address  322m4vNRFihmAYEr5ZqdPmQHd2XTPWtirq
  • 2c240999e678d71fb29ea1b2aa5980ded794453c81a81e8134d92178b9558f99:1
  • value  3307358
    address  18DzmLZ6gY5ixwYcbTq43pg15Vov5SjfL5